Running Windows 10 on a 2012 MacBook Pro via Boot Camp is an excellent way to get more life out of classic hardware. However, many users encounter two frustrating, interconnected problems after installation: the internal speakers produce no sound (often showing a "No Audio Output Device is installed" error), and the laptop runs incredibly hot.

If you see the error "" next to your High Definition Audio Controller in Device Manager, or if your sound icon has a red "X", your Windows is likely installed in UEFI mode .
running Windows 10, the most common issue is that Windows was installed in instead of Legacy BIOS mode . On this specific model, the internal speakers and microphone often only work if Windows is installed using the Master Boot Record (MBR) partition scheme. 🛠️ Immediate Fixes to Try First
